Another
member of the Sculptor galaxy group, the nearly edge-on spiral NGC 247
is similar in size to its famous neighbor NGC 253, but it is much fainter.
About 5o north of the Sculptor Galaxy, look for NGC 247 as a very faint smudge of light. Use low magnifications (~50x or less). The nuclear region is just barely visible in a six-inch under dark skies. Larger scopes may show some mottling in the surrounding haze.
